Sunteți pe pagina 1din 2

1) Să se afişeze primii n termeni ai următoarelor şiruri:

a) 1, 2, 4, 8, …
b) 1, 21, 123, 4321, 12345, …
c) 1, 2, 1, 1, 2, 3, 4, 3, 2, 1, 1, 2, 3, 4, 5, 6, 5, 4, …

2) Să se determine al n-lea termen al şirului:


1, 1, 2, 1, 2, 3, 1, 2, 3, 4, 1, 2, 3, 4, 5, … fără a folosi tipuri structurate de date.
Exemplu. Al 55-lea termen al şirului este 10.

3) Să se calculeze expresia

ştiind că ea conţine n fracţii (se numără inclusiv 1).

4) În povestea "Jack şi vrejul de fasole", Jack trebuia să ajungă în Ţara Uriaşului, situată
la x metrii deasupra pământului, urcând cu vrejul de fasole care avea proprietatea
miraculoasă de a creşte în fiecare minut cu 1/2, 1/3, 1/4 etc. din înălţimea lui anterioară
(înălţimea iniţială a vrejului este 1 m). În câte minute ajunge Jack în Ţara Uriaşului?
Exemplu. Dacă x=300 Jack ajunge în vârf după 598 de minute.

5) Introduceţi de la tastatură o rată medie de creştere a populaţiei Terrei şi calculaţi după


câţi ani faţă de 1992 se va dubla populaţia. (În 1992 Terra avea o populaţie de 5480
milioane de locuitori).
Exemplu. Dacă rata de creştere este de 0.05 (adică 5% pe an) atunci populaţia se dublează
în 15 ani.

6) La o societate sunt n (n1). Următorul ca importanţă deţine jumătate din procentul


deţinut de primul, următorul jumătate din procentul deţinut de al doilea, etc. Realizaţi
un program care tipăreşte suma deţinută de ultimul acţionar.
Exemplu. Dacă sunt 5 acţionari iar suma deţinută de primul acţionar este de 130 de
milioane atunci ultimul acţionar deţine 8.125 milioane (adică 8 milioane şi …).

7) Scrieţi un program care va citi un întreg şi un caracter. Programul va afişa un romb


compus din caracterul citit de la tastatură şi având lăţimea specificată de întreg. Dacă
întregul este un număr par, el va fi mărit cu 1.
Exemplu. Dacă întregul este 5 şi caracterul este 'X', rombul va arăta astfel:

8) O carte se paginează cu numere de la 1 la n (20n10000, n natural). Fiind dat n, să se


afle câte cifre au fost folosite la paginare. Invers, dacă se dă numărul m de cifre pentru
paginare, să se afle numărul de pagini al cărţii.
Exemplu. Pentru o carte cu 100 de pagini se folosesc 192 de cifre (9 pagini cu câte 1 cifră;
90 de pagini cu câte două cifre; 1 pagină cu 3 cifre).

S-ar putea să vă placă și